    Abstract: A metal member-welded structure includes: a Cu member; an Al member; and a welded portion formed by melting and solidifying each of materials of the Cu member and the Al member. The Cu member includes a Cu-based material containing Cu as a main component. The Al member includes an Al-based material containing Al as a main component and a plating layer that covers a side of the Al-based material, the side being close to a surface of the Cu member. The welded portion includes a sea-island structure in a vicinity of the surface of the Cu member. The sea-island structure includes: a plurality of island portions containing pure Al, and a sea portion interposed among the island portions. The sea portion has a eutectic structure having: a phase of an intermetallic compound of Cu and Al; and a phase of pure Al.

    Abstract: An improved lens unit can be used in an in-vehicle camera or the like, in a condition where a forefront lens is exposed to the outside for a long time. Here, the resin lens within the lens unit has an improved durability at a high temperature. The lens unit has a plurality of lenses arranged side by side with the optical axes thereof aligned with each other. The lenses include glass lens and resin lens. The lens closest to the object is a glass lens which is closest to the object side and is coated with an ultra-hard film. Resin lenses each have a high temperature resistant reflection preventing film. The lens is a combined lens in which a lens and a lens are bonded together, and is then covered with a high temperature resistant reflection preventing film after bonding.

    Abstract: A bus bar includes a metal plate material. A plate face of the metal plate material includes a recessed portion. An inner wall of the recessed portion includes a first light-receiving face that is inclined relative to the plate face so as to receive a laser light beam L1 extending in a direction perpendicular to the plate face, and a second light-receiving face for receiving the laser light beam L1 that has reflected off the first light-receiving face.
